Cleaning costs depend on a few specific things regarding your fireplace setup. We look at the total height of the chimney, the number of flues, and how much creosote buildup has accumulated over time. If your chimney has been neglected for several seasons, or if there are blockages like animal nests or heavy debris, the labor required increases. The type of liner and the fireplace architecture also play a role in the complexity of the service.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

When a licensed professional comes to your Tucson home, they'll thoroughly inspect your chimney's interior and exterior. They'll remove creosote buildup, soot, and blockages like bird nests. This ensures your chimney functions safely and efficiently. The goal is to prevent fire hazards and carbon monoxide issues. They'll also check the damper and flue for proper operation.
You might notice a strong, smoky smell lingering in your home even when the fireplace isn't in use. Soot falling from the fireplace or a visible layer of black soot inside the flue are also clear indicators. If you see a lot of debris or have had a chimney fire, it's time. While you might be tempted to tackle chimney cleaning yourself in Tucson, it's generally best left to the professionals. They have the specialized tools and knowledge to do a thorough and safe job. Improper cleaning can leave behind dangerous creosote or even damage your chimney. Professionals ensure it's done right, protecting your home.
For most Tucson homes, having your chimney cleaned and inspected annually is recommended. This is especially true if you use your fireplace or wood stove regularly. Even occasional use can lead to creosote buildup over time. A yearly check ensures everything is in good working order and safe for use.
The ideal time for chimney cleaning in Tucson is generally during the spring or early fall. This avoids the busy winter heating season when professionals are in high demand. Scheduling in the spring allows you to address any issues from the past winter. An early fall appointment ensures your chimney is ready for the cooler months.
